Manchester United Consider Late Move for Mario Hermoso
In a surprise development, Manchester United are exploring a potential signing of La Liga star Mario Hermoso, a free agent after leaving Atlético Madrid. According to reports, the club’s board is discussing the possibility of bringing in the left-footed centre-back, who can also play left-back.
Manager Erik ten Hag is keen on Hermoso, citing the need for a player who fits the profile of what the team requires. Ten Hag emphasized the importance of minimizing risks and maximizing opportunities, suggesting that Hermoso’s versatility and experience make him an attractive option.
Fans are overwhelmingly supportive of the potential signing, recognizing the value of acquiring a talented player without a transfer fee. Hermoso’s ability to play both centre-back and left-back addresses a key area of need, providing competition for Luke Shaw and bolstering the team’s defensive depth.
